python3.6导入cookiejar失败处理方案

2025-04-19 12:46:36

小编的python是3.6版本的,在编写代码时,需要导入cookiejar,cookiejar这个包本应是python自带的,但是导入却失败了,在这里提供两种解决方案,读者根据自己所需自行选择

python3.6导入cookiejar失败处理方案

方案一

1、解决方案一:将import cookiejar改为http.cookiejar

python3.6导入cookiejar失败处理方案

2、这时候,如果需要引用cookiejar包中的方法,只需要带上http.cookiejar就可以了。

python3.6导入cookiejar失败处理方案

方案二

1、解决方案二:将import cookiejar改为from http import cookiejar

python3.6导入cookiejar失败处理方案

2、使用这种方案,在调用cookiejar包中的方法,仅仅只需要带上cookiejar就可以了。如果你只需要使用http中的cooki髫潋啜缅ejar包,小编在这强力推荐使用方案二导入,因为方案二导入方式是指向定向的cookiejar文件,之后在调用cookiejar中的方法时,可以省去大量的和http.,除了节省代码,还节省了时间

python3.6导入cookiejar失败处理方案

3、两种方案的区别,相信在导入和使用的过程中已经深刻体会到了。前者指定http.cookiejar,但是python记忆里保存了http.cookiejar,但并没有进入http.cookiej锾攒揉敫ar,只是在http门口待着,等待使用,也就是在cookiejar上面还有个http文件夹框着,你想使用里面的东西得和http说声,http告知cookiejar,得到cookiejar允许后才能使用,后者是直接指向了http.cookiejar包里,想使用cookiejar里的谁,只需要告知cookiejar一声就可以了

python3.6导入cookiejar失败处理方案
声明:本网站引用、摘录或转载内容仅供网站访问者交流或参考,不代表本站立场,如存在版权或非法内容,请联系站长删除,联系邮箱:site.kefu@qq.com。
猜你喜欢